**Mgmt Meeting Minutes — Retiring the Brightline Range**

Quick recap for sales leads at Fenholt Supplies: we agreed to retire the Brightline fixture range by year-end. Remaining stock moves to clearance pricing next month, and accounts on standing orders get migrated to the Lumetta range. Trade-in incentives were approved in principle. The confidential note on next steps sits just below.

board note of bajof-bajeg: The pricing group signed off on a budget of $13.4 million for Project Sildor. The renewal with Lamixek Holdings closes at $48.9 million a year, 49 percent above the last contract.

## Per-Tenant Rate Quotas (Veldrin Gateway)

Every tenant on the Veldrin Gateway is metered per endpoint class. Exceeding a quota returns a retryable throttle response, never a hard failure, so downstream jobs should back off rather than alarm. Contractors must not raise quotas in config overrides; file a capacity request instead. The enforced defaults are listed below.

tuning table, yajog-yahof:
BUDGETS = {
    "lamvan": 303,
    "wenox": 460,
    "fenvan": 525,
}

TURN-208: Gatevale turnstile counters at the Merrow Field pilot double-count when a rotation reverses mid-cycle. Attendance totals drift roughly 2% high per event. The debounce window fix is implemented, reviewed by Ilsa, and soak-tested across two simulated match days without drift. Ready for your cut; the candidate build is identified below.

trace token, tagag-tafog: htk6_5ed18c